Unmanned air delivery is planned to be tested in St. Petersburg
[ad_1]
In St. Petersburg, they plan to test the delivery of goods by flying drones. The Ministry of Economic Development approved the proposal of the Fly Dron IT company and a number of drone manufacturers to establish an appropriate experimental legal regime (EPR) in the city. This follows from the draft government decree, which is at the disposal of Vedomosti. Its authenticity was confirmed by a representative of the Ministry of Economic Development.
At the moment, the document is at the stage of coordination with the Ministry of Transport, ANO Tsifrovaya ekonomika, the government of St. Petersburg, the Ministry of Industry and Trade, the Federal Air Transport Agency, Rostransnadzor and the FSB, the representative of the Ministry of Economic Development specified. According to him, the establishment of an EPR is planned for the second quarter of 2023. The EPR is valid for three years, follows from the document.
